Output 1caa3b0660b2e590ae8c113f832cec9cd5f7f716b8fd9ceba4db5ef9a3a497e7:2

value
12555861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bec7f8f6a34cd78c253636d08f83cddfb984d6 OP_EQUAL
address
MJTAVCNWFzxUdtY2vo3sqPrqTn7d6JtbiU
transaction
1caa3b0660b2e590ae8c113f832cec9cd5f7f716b8fd9ceba4db5ef9a3a497e7
spent
true